❓ How do your CNG compressors handle varying inlet pressures?

Our Variable Frequency Drive (VFD) technology dynamically adjusts motor speed to compensate for inlet pressure fluctuations. Key features include:

  • Automatic suction pressure regulation: Maintains optimal compression ratio regardless of inlet conditions (2-30 bar range).
  • Anti-surge control: Prevents damage from sudden pressure drops or spikes.
  • Load balancing: Distributes wear evenly across cylinders in multi-stage units.

According to our 2024 field data, Enric compressors maintain ±1% discharge pressure stability even with ±20% inlet pressure variation.

❓ Can your CNG compressors handle sour gas (H₂S/CO₂ content)?

Yes, with custom configurations. We offer sour gas-resistant models for feed gas with:

  • H₂S: Up to 500 ppm (standard) or 5,000 ppm (with special coating).
  • CO₂: Up to 5% by volume.

Key modifications for sour gas:

  • Material upgrades: Duplex stainless steel (2205) for cylinders and valves.
  • Seal materials: HNBR or FFKM for H₂S resistance.
  • Gas scrubbing: Integrated activated carbon filters to remove contaminants.
  • Corrosion monitoring: Ultrasonic thickness gauges for real-time material degradation tracking.

Note: Higher H₂S/CO₂ concentrations may require pre-treatment. Contact our engineers for a gas analysis review.
